Ave.ai is rolling out a new trading contest with BNB Chain, Four.meme, and Flap. It’s called the "bStocks Sprint Trading Competition," and the total prize pool is 150,000 USDT. The event starts at 21:00 on September 3 and ends at 23:59 on September 17, 2026 (UTC+8).
There are three tracks in all. The Sunshine Award asks for a minimum cumulative trading volume of 200 USDT, and 40,000 USDT will be shared across all eligible users. The bStocks Ecosystem Comprehensive Trading Board is for traders who hit 20,000 USDT in volume, with the top 500 users dividing 60,000 USDT. Then there’s the Four.meme Special Trading Board. That one centers on Stock Meme tokens issued by Four.meme, also with a 20,000 USDT volume requirement, and 50,000 USDT set aside for the top 500 traders.
The competition lands as the wider market keeps pushing tokenized real-world assets and stock-based tokens. RWA (Real-World Assets) are still driving on-chain innovation, while tokenized stocks are linking traditional finance with crypto. And events like this widen trading options for assets like bStocks and Stock Meme, giving users more ways to take part in the on-chain stock narrative.
